【发布时间】:2020-11-26 09:45:02
【问题描述】:
我是 Helidon SE 的新手,想知道是否可以通过使用 Helidon SE 创建的 REST 服务将文件上传到 Oracle DB(Blob/Clob 列)。
【问题讨论】:
标签: java oracle rest file helidon
我是 Helidon SE 的新手,想知道是否可以通过使用 Helidon SE 创建的 REST 服务将文件上传到 Oracle DB(Blob/Clob 列)。
【问题讨论】:
标签: java oracle rest file helidon
Helidon 存储库中提供的文件上传/下载示例:https://github.com/oracle/helidon/tree/master/examples/media/multipart
不过,此示例使用磁盘来存储/检索文件,但您可以将其替换为 JDBC 读取/插入。
根据 LOB 大小,最好以反应方式上传/下载文件(如上面的示例)并在拥有所有位时读取/插入位。
(除了Oracle DB 20c available in preview with JDBC Reactive extension 我还没有检查过,但很可能你可以让它从端到端完全反应。)
【讨论】: